F&M trunk shows, now in LA

So as many New Yorkers know, Freddy&Ma often does both in home trunk shows for customers as well as individual appointments for people interested in designing bags.  We have now extended that capacity to the Los Angeles area with the addition of Tricia Schmidt to our team here at F&M.

Tricia is a rock star - super chic, extremely witty and she has a GREAT personal aesthetic.  Oh, and she is a textile designer to boot. If you live in the LA area and would like to host a trunk show or setup a personal design appointment, contact Trica at tricia@freddyandma.com .

And if you live somewhere else, but would still like to host an F&M trunk show in your home or office, contact info@freddyandma.com.  If enough people are going to show up, we don't mind hitting the road with our trunk full of fabrics, leathers and sample bags :-)
